Physical Therapy Assistant Jobs in Nevada
Physical Therapy Assistant jobs in Nevada are concentrated in outpatient orthopedic clinics, hospital rehabilitation units, and skilled nursing facilities, with steady demand in Las Vegas, Reno, and Henderson across career levels from new graduates to experienced clinicians. Major employers with an established footprint in the state include Intermountain Health, Kindred Healthcare, and Encompass Health, all of which maintain active rehabilitation programs across Nevada. Geriatric rehabilitation, orthopedic recovery, and neuro rehab are the most consistently sought specialties in current Nevada listings. Position Purpose
This position is accountable for providing quality Physical Therapy services under the supervision of the Therapy Supervisor, Manager and, ultimately, the Director of Rehabilitation Therapies. This individual provides comprehensive physical therapy services to pediatric, adolescent, adult and geriatric patients in therapy settings across the health system, including their families/caregivers. Services include, but are not limited to, comprehensive evaluation and treatment of gait and transfer limitations, orthotic/prosthetic training and comprehensive wound care.
Nature and Scope
The incumbent must provide optimal patient care through assessment, planning, implementation and evaluation of pediatric, adolescent, adult and geriatric patients in all therapy settings. This position conducts evaluations, develops appropriate plan of care, and provides rehabilitation services through time of discharge from the facility. This position is responsible for the direct clinical supervision of staff physical therapy assistants and rehab technicians.
Therapist is expected to provide services interchangeably among “like facilities.” For example, acute care staff may float between inpatient hospital settings, while post-acute staff may provide services within various post-acute facility settings based upon census and business needs.
At times, this position may be asked to participate in program development and outcome measurements in the clinical setting.
Per diem staff is required to work at least 1 major and 1 minor holiday each year. Major holidays are defined as Thanksgiving Day, the day after Thanksgiving, Christmas Eve and Christmas Day. Minor holidays are defined as New Years Eve, New Years Day, Memorial Day, 4th of July and Labor Day. If an area is closed on major holidays, the requirement is to work at least 1 day the week of the holiday period.
This position does provide patient care.

Physical Therapy Assistant Jobs in Nevada: Frequently Asked Questions
How do you become a physical therapy assistant in Nevada?
You must earn an associate degree from a program accredited by the Commission on Accreditation in Physical Therapy Education, pass the National Physical Therapy Examination for PTAs, and obtain a license from the Nevada Physical Therapy Board before practicing in Nevada. Applications go through the Nevada Physical Therapy Board, which also handles license renewals and continuing education requirements. No reciprocity shortcut exists, so out-of-state applicants must apply directly to the Board.

Are there remote physical therapy assistant jobs in Nevada?
Yes, but they're rare. Physical therapy assistant work is fundamentally hands-on and performed alongside patients in clinical settings, so most roles require an on-site presence. How can I get hired as a physical therapy assistant in Nevada with little or no experience?
The most realistic entry path is applying to new-graduate positions at skilled nursing facilities and inpatient rehabilitation hospitals, which tend to hire recent graduates more readily than outpatient orthopedic clinics. Encompass Health and Kindred Healthcare, both active in Nevada, offer structured clinical onboarding for new PTAs. Candidates who worked as rehabilitation aides or physical therapy technicians during their degree program have a clear advantage, and holding an active Nevada Physical Therapy Board license before applying removes the most common hiring delay.
